To an artist, there is nothing more valuable than creativity. Creativity fuels all expression, but what happens when the tank runs dry? The Artist's Way: A Spiritual Path to Higher Creativity leads readers through a 12-week program designed to reawaken and stimulate the senses. It knocks out the blocks of fear, jealousy, guilt and addictions and opens up the doors so that artistic confidence can flourish. Linking creativity to spirituality, the book shows how to channel your energies towards a more productive and fulfilling artistic life.

    Julia Cameron's book is truly amazing IF you put her recommendations into practice: doing the morning pages, weekly artist date and a few of the exercises each week. I am currently in week 6 (of 12) and after working my way through it, I have honestly noticed more synchronicity and a general feeling of more possibility in the world. There are more practical get-going-and-write books out there, such as Natalie Goldberg's Writing Down the Bones, but the Artist's Way is really fantastic at guiding you through the process of listening to your inner critic and doing the work despite your worries about quality, acceptance, etc.
